Distiller Notes
Cuvée Révélation is the prestige expression of Grand Marnier with the most Cognac-forward taste, thanks to an extremely high Cognac content bringing exceptional deepness and length on the palate.
Blending is where the utmost mastery shines. In Grande Cuvée Révélation 68 eaux-de-vie exclusively from Grande Champagne are harmoniously blended in a rare XXO cognac, with min ageing of 14 years. The fresh and round bitter orange perfectly matches this remarkable Cognac and its exclusive woody, tobacco and dry plum facets, creating an intriguing encounter.
Medium amber tinged with copper. Intense woody and tobacco notes of old cognac balanced by dry plum and delicate orange on the nose. On the palate, woody, walnut with round bitter orange and vanilla facets.
First prepared by 13th century Italian monks as herbal medicines and elixirs, Liqueurs are distilled spirits that have been combined with flavoring agents. A range of herbs, spices, nuts, fruits and flowers can be used, and a sweetener such as sugar or corn syrup is often added. While typically rather sweet, some examples are herbaceous or tart and pair exceptionally well with desserts or act as a delightful addition to cocktails.
